For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 512 students in the neighborhood of Walker Homes, Memphis, TN.
The top-ranked public school in Walker Homes is Ford Road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Walker Homes, Memphis, TN public school have an average math proficiency score of 8% (versus the Tennessee public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 11% (versus the 37%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Tennessee public school average of 43% (majority Black).
